St. Theresa Catholic School

Virtual Open House

Explore our school with this virtual program!

Our School Mission:

Guided by the teachings of Christ, Saint Theresa Catholic School is dedicated to Educating Tomorrow’s Catholic Leaders. We partner with families in the spiritual, intellectual, social, and physical development of every child.

Pastor/Principal Welcome

Video-FrH1.mov

Fr. James Hudgins

Pastor of St. Theresa Catholic Parish

Erin Welcome.mp4

Mrs. Erin O'Malley

Principal of St. Theresa Catholic School

Discover what St. Theresa Catholic School is all about!

Explore the different facets of STCS by clicking below.

Learn More About...

STCS Community Tile 1 .mp4

Our Community

Our Faith and Service to Others Tile 2.mp4

Our Faith &
Service to Others

Grades K-2 Tile 3.mp4

Grades K-2

Grades 3-5 Tile 4.mp4

Grades 3-5

Grades 6-8 MS Tile 5.mp4

Middle School

Student Support Tile 6.mp4

Student Support Services

Specials & Activities Tile 7.mp4

Specials & Activities

Extended Day Care Tile 8.mp4

Extended Day Care

Virtual Tour

Enjoy viewing these photos which highlight our beautiful, welcoming campus.

Click on the photos above to see inside the school...

Click on the photos above to view the grounds...

Our Application Process for 2022-2023 begins in November.

  1. Once submitted, Application are reviewed in January.

  2. Acceptance Letters will go out in March.


Frequently Requested Information...

  • STCS is a Kindergarten through 8th grade Diocesan Catholic School, established in 1994.

  • We have two classes of each grade, and currently have 430 students from 270 families.

  • Class Size: Our average class size in 2019-2020 was 24 students, and the student/faculty ratio was 12:1.

  • Class Limits: Kindergarten is capped at 25 students per classroom, 1st grade is capped at 28, and 2nd-8th grades are capped at 30. (non-pandemic number limits)

  • Students in 1st - 8th grade go to Mass each week. Kindergarten attends twice per month.

  • Students in Elementary School (K-5) use iPads in the classroom.

  • Each student in Middle School is issued a Chromebook. It becomes their own upon graduation.

  • Middle School students go to the following classes every day: religion, math, language arts, reading, science, social studies. Spanish is four days per week.

  • Spanish is taught from kindergarten through 8th grade.

  • Kindergarten is a full-day program with a teacher and full-time aide. The classrooms are designed with younger students in mind, and both include a bathroom.

  • Grades 1-3 have a part-time aide in each room.

  • We have Interactive Boards in every classroom for teacher and student use.

  • Students wear uniforms each day. Kindergarten has its own uniform, grades 1-5 wear the elementary school uniform, and grades 6-8 wear the middle school uniform. There is a separate P.E. uniform, which students wear for the entirety of their P.E. day.

  • Of our 2019-2020 graduates, 62% attend Paul VI Catholic High School in Loudoun County. Our graduates also attend public high schools including Academy of Sciences.

  • All of our teachers are certified to teach in Virginia.

  • In non-pandemic years, hot lunch is offered with a pre-ordering/pre-pay system.

  • Our Extended Day Care Program begins at dismissal and is open until 6:00 PM

To Schedule a Tour / Receive More Information:

  • Click here to schedule an in-person tour (if available) and/or to have more information about our admissions process emailed to you.


  • Thank you for taking part in our Virtual Open House. We look forward to seeing you!


Note: Photographs were taken prior to the COVID-19 pandemic.